The development of the maintenance operations safety survey: challenges in transferring a predictive safety tool from flight operations to aircraft maintenance
Predicting human behaviour and managing human error is arguably the greatest challenge facing the
aviation industry today (Shappell and Wiegmann, 2009). In order to gain a better understanding of
human behaviour and overall organizational safety performance, the industry is moving towards
monitoring of normal operations (Helmreich et al., 2003). One of the key advantages is the learning
opportunity without the negative consequences and associated costs of an incident or accident.
Predictive tools such as the Line Operations Safety Audit (LOSA) provide objective information of routine
operational performance, complement existing safety data collection programs and are endorsed by the
International Civil Aviation Organization (ICAO)
